Quotes from U.S. players, coach
prior to start of Squash competition in Rio
de Janeiro, Brazil. by Craig Sesker, USOC Press
JAMIE CROMBIE
“Natalie (Grainger) is just an amazing player – she
has a great chance to win this tournament. She’s been
a great addition to our team.”
“A lot of people see me and think I’m a coach.
I’ve managed to keep my level of play high enough
to make another team. It’s fun to be a part of a great
event like this. Squash is like high-speed chess where there
is a thinking part and a part where you have to react quickly.”
"This is my third Pan American Games, but I'm just as excited
about the Opening Ceremonies this year as I've ever been.
Having an opportunity to represent your country in a sold
out stadium of 80 or 90,000 people is pretty incredible
and amazing. It's going to be crazy. For a sport like squash,
you don't get a whole lot of attention so it's really neat
for us to be a part of the Opening Ceremonies."

MICHELLE QUIBELL
“The Pan Am Games are a really big event for Squash
because we’re not yet an Olympic sport. This is the
big event that we really look forward to. We’re really
excited and pumped up for this tournament.”
"The Brazilians are such sports fanatics anyway, so they'll
really be into it for the Opening Ceremonies. All the athletes
will really be into it too so it should be an unbelievable
experience."
